Taxes are the ultimate "adulting" nightmare. Most of us left school knowing the Pythagorean theorem but with zero clue how to file a tax return. That’s where Paulina Casso’s book, WTF con el SAT, comes in as a literal lifesaver. What’s the Book About?
It’s a practical, funny guide that breaks down the Mexican tax system using memes and pop culture references. Instead of boring legal jargon, Casso explains:
How the SAT works: Understanding our "worst enemy," the Servicio de Administración Tributaria.
Tax Basics: Why they take so much of your money and what actually happens to it.
Registration: How to sign up without accidentally putting a "noose around your neck".
Daily Tasks: Issuing electronic invoices (CFDI 4.0) and making your annual declaration. Investing: How taxes affect your investments. Why You Shouldn't Just Look for a Google Drive PDF

Support the Author: Paulina Casso is a young entrepreneur recognized by Entrepreneur and Mujer Ejecutiva for making complex topics accessible.
Stay Updated: Tax laws in Mexico change frequently. Casso aims to update the book annually to match the latest Resolución Miscelánea Fiscal. An old PDF from a random drive might give you outdated (and potentially dangerous) advice.
Legitimate Access: You can find the ebook on platforms like OverDrive through library systems or purchase it on Amazon and Rakuten Kobo. The Verdict
